Giro
de Baile the NorthMayo/Erris Sportive
Now
in it's third year, Giro de Baile is going from strength to
strength, and is fast becoming one of the country's premier
cycling sportives. Modelled on the famous Ring of Kerry cycle
and sanctioned by Cycling Ireland, it encompasses 146km
of the most stunning Mayo North scenery, most of it along
the Wild Atlantic Way. This year's event takes
place on the August Bank Holiday weekend, with the main cycle
taking place on Sunday 31st July at 10.00am
from Ballycastle town centre.
The
event is community run and this year, five charities will
benefit –
Naomh
Padraig Juvenile GAA, Mayo Roscommon Hospice Foundation, Irish
Cancer Society and Family Carers Ireland .
Routes
There
will be two routes available to participants – for the more
experienced, the 146km route follows a wonderfully scenic
course from Ballycastle Village right along the North Mayo
coast through Lacken, Killala, Crossmolina, cycling right
into the heart of Erris through Bangor, Barnatra, Pullathomas,
Cornboy and Belderrig before returning to Ballycastle. This
route along the sheer coast of the Atlantic is truly spectacular,
passing scenic highlights like the famous Downpatrick Head,
now a Wild Atlantic Way Signature Discovery Point, Lacken
Strand, Porturlin and the Stags of Broadhaven.
For
the intermediate or leisure cyclist, the 60km route takes
in the parishes of Ballycastle, Lacken, Killala, Cooneal,
Crossmolina, Moygownagh and Kilfian with many of the highlights
above included on the route.
Inclusive
The
Giro de Baile prides itself on being a community run, non-competitive
day out. Novice cyclists do not need to feel intimidated as
the event is primarily a fun and relaxed day out
on your bike with like-minded people. While the event will
be timed, you are only riding against yourself, the clock
and the course.
New
addition for 2016 – the Vintage and Family Cycle
?This
year, on Saturday evening 30 th July at 5.30pm, cyclists and
families are invited to bring their vintage bikes (pre-90s
steel is the standard, but anything goes!), gear and memorabilia,
and take part in a short spin from Ballycastle Community Hall
to Downpatrick Head. There will be tea, coffee and an opportunity
to take in the breathtaking views before returning to Ballycastle.
The event is sponsored by Tea
by the Sea .
